Dear Haskellers,

I've got the following error message during
compilation of the attached Signal.hs file with ghc 6.4
and 6.5.

ghc -c Signal.hs
ghc-6.4: panic! (the `impossible' happened, GHC version
6.4):
types/Type.lhs:(1107,0)-(1108,77):
Non-exhaustive patterns in function zip_ty_env


Please report it as a compiler bug to
glasgow-haskell-bugs@xxxxxxxxxxx,
or http://sourceforge.net/projects/ghc/.

I spent some time stripping the file to only several
lines :)

Excellent bug report, thank you. Turns out that this was a
clerical error in a minor function, which has been in GHC for
ages. Fixed now, though; tc183 tests for it.
